There is final recognition from the FDA in the United Sates that Olive oil is good for and can prevent heart disease. Allowing producers to add “qualified health claims” on their bottles is a huge step for olive oil producers. Olive oil producers can now choose to advertise their product as a heart-healthy alternative to animal-based fats for cooking and food preparation.
Italy conducted research into the health benefits of olive oil and came the conclusion that some fats are not just nutrients but also have excellent health benefits and medicinal properties. The amount of olive oil suggested is 2 tablespoons of extra virgin olive oil every day. This consumption is to replace the saturated fats that are already in your daily diet not on top of it, avoiding an increase in your daily calories.
What are the ingredients of olive oil?
High Levels of mono-unsaturated fatty acids and polyphenol compounds are the ingredients that are most likely to give great health benefits. It is the type of fat rather than the total fat content that is important. Diets that are high in mono-unsaturated fatty acids add health benefits as opposed to those diets that only contain polyunsaturated fats.
Olive oil ingredients include Vitamin E , Oleic acid, Carotenoids , Phenols and Squalene, all of which have great health benefits on their own.
Scientific Studies have now concluded that olive oil has tremendous health benefits:
- Reduces inflammation, so can assist with alleviation of rheumatoid arthritis and other inflammatory conditions.
- Increases good cholesterol in our bodies so in turn reduces the bad cholesterol.
- Glucose in the body becomes more stable so can assist people with diabetes.
- Improves the dilation of arteries, so reduces blood pressure, improves abnormal heart rhythms and can reducing the risk of attack and stroke.
- Olive oil acts as an antioxidant to prevent oxidation damage to tissues.
Make sure you choose the right olive oil
Extra Virgin Olive oil and Virgin olive oil are the best choices for health benefits as products called olive oil only contain about 10% or virgin olive oil. The best way to incorporate olive oil in your diet is over salads, drizzling over steamed vegetables.
